http://hrlibrary.umn.edu/edumat/hreduseries/hereandnow/Part-1/whatare.htm WebHuman rights are the rights a person has. simply because he or she is a human being. Human rights are held by all persons equally, universally, and forever. Human rights are inalienable: you cannot lose these rights any more than you can cease being a human being.
